TheMadMan697 Posted January 8, 2011 Share Posted January 8, 2011 I am having a bit of trouble with a BSOD. I Think it might be my SSD's I have got two blue screens today while i was a way from the pc i have not had any blue screen for ages and the only thing i have done is updated the firmware on my two Corsair F60 SSD's from version 1.0 to version 2.0 and did a secure erase of the drives. The drives are running in raid 0 Under power options I have sleep disabled and i have it set to turn off my monitors after 10 minutes if the pc is idle. Both of the blue screens i got today have happened while i was away from my pc so i am thinking it might be something to do with the monitors turning off. I have herd of people having problem with these drives and sleep mode but i haven’t come across anything else causing blue screens. If anyone has any info that could help me out that would be great. EDIT: I think i may have found the problem. I think it’s actually the ati drives that i updated the day before. I went back to the old ones and no problems yet.
